British Man Trades Frequent Flyer Miles for Space Shot

lvmoon writes "Start saving up your airline miles. Alan Watts, a British businessman, was able to use his 2,000,000 frequent flyer miles for a space flight, a ticket aboard a 2009 Virgin Galactic space flight." From the article: "Electrician Alan Watts said he flew to and from the United States on Virgin Atlantic flights more than 40 times in the past six years, earning him enough miles to take the trip into space with Virgin's space wing, London's The Sun newspaper reported Friday. The trip cost 2 million frequent flier miles, compared to the 90,000 miles required for a first-class flight from London to New York."     1. Re:Hyperinflation in the Airmiles currency by tgd · · Score: 4, Informative

      An interesting theory... however, twelve years ago I was investigating various ways of doing product promotions and had looked quite a bit at frequent flyer promotions. At the time I could buy frequent flyer miles at eight cents a piece (with substantial discounts for VERY large purchases), and generally they applied towards tickets in the ten cent per mile price. (25,000 frequent flier miles for a round trip ticket of approximately $2500 peak value -- the average seat cost being based on the highest available fare for that seat type)

      At two million frequent flier miles for a $200k ticket, they gave him ten cents value a piece today, as well. I haven't looked, but I would guess the cost to buy miles hasn't changed either (or even kept pace with inflation). What has changed is discount airlines pulling prices down, so the disconnect between the price you're "paying" for FF miles and the vlaue you get back isn't as good since its trivial to find non-peak price seats on flights.

  6. Exact opposite is true: a great future in space by Anonymous Coward · · Score: 5, Insightful

    Space travel is a temporary situation. It will cost too much and become unfeasible in the next 50 - 100 years.

    You have that back to front. The current difficulty of doing space travel is temporary, because it is the result of poor strength of materials and poor energy usage.

    Materials technology is improving at an extraordinary pace, and there is now a whole industry dedicated to manufacturing nanotubes of one form or another, despite this being only the beginning of work on nanoscale materials. Much greater things are on the way. And with stronger, lighter materials you can build much better space-worthy craft, not only hugely safer in the hostile medium but also able to withstand greater dynamic forces more safely. And more cheaply!

    Then we come to energy. Contrary to the daily propaganda of environmentalists, there is no shortage of energy on the planet --- the surface of the Earth receives about 150 thousand times more energy from the sun than mankind is forecast to need by the year 2020. Our "energy problems" simply reflect our poor ability to harness that near-zero-cost energy, currently.

    But that can change, especially in the context of space flight.

    For a start, we can rise up through the bulk of the atmosphere almost without any energy cost at all, and many outfits are already experimenting with that, to the very edge of space.

    And secondly, once up there, solar energy is freely available, and as long as there is still residual atmosphere around you, this gives you matter which you can use for propulsion, slowly building up speed as you skip through the upper layers. A relatively small amount of extra reaction mass is needed to boost the orbit out the final few dozen miles once you have close to orbital speed.

    In due course then, on materials and energy grounds there is every reason to forecast a very bright and buoyant future for space travel. NASA-type costs are not required, as long as you're not in a hurry.
